The Australia and New Zealand announcement follows extraordinary demand for The Romantic Tour, which delivered the largest single-day ticket sales in Live Nation history across North America, Europe, and the UK, while setting a new Ticketmaster record with 2.1 million tickets sold in a single day.

The tour follows the arrival of Bruno Mars’ long-awaited fourth solo album, The Romantic, which was the biggest debut album of his career. The project officially debuted at No. 1 on the Billboard 200, marking his first album ever to premiere at the top spot, and second No. 1 album on the chart after Unorthodox Jukebox in more than a decade. The album also hit No. 1 on Apple’s Global Album Chart, No. 1 on Spotify’s Global Album Chart, and No. 1 on Spotify’s Top US Album Chart. It features songs including the explosive “I Just Might,” which is Bruno’s 10th No. 1 single and inaugural No. 1 debut, as well as “Risk It All,” which landed at No. 1 on the Billboard Global 200 Chart and Billboard Streaming Songs List, and hit the No.1 spot on both Apple and Spotify’s Global and US song charts.

The new tour builds on an incredible few years of global performances for Mars, including his acclaimed Las Vegas residency at Dolby Live at Park MGM and an extensive and record-breaking international touring run throughout Australia, Asia, the Middle East, and South America. In early 2024, Mars became the first international artist of the 21st century to hold seven consecutive sold-out concerts at the Tokyo Dome. In the fall of 2024, he achieved the highest-grossing tour in Brazilian history, performing 14 sold-out stadium shows across Brazil, spanning five cities — Rio de Janeiro, São Paulo, Brasília, Belo Horizonte, and Curitiba. In August of 2024, Mars also opened Los Angeles’ brand-new arena, Intuit Dome, with two sold-out performances, one of which featured a surprise on-stage duet with Lady Gaga, where they debuted the first live performance of “Die with a Smile.”
